Here is a guide to Milwaukee's Memorial Day Parade and Ceremony:

Milwaukee's 153rd-annual Memorial Day Parade will be held Monday, May 28, 2018 at steps off at 2 p.m. at the intersection of Fourth Street and Wisconsn Ave. and ends at Veterans Park.

Memorial Day Activities immediately follow the parade at Veterans Park, including:

  • Wreath-Laying Ceremony at the War Memorial Center Reflecting Pool
  • Vietnam Veterans Memorial Brick Dedication Ceremony at the War Memorial Center Reflecting Pool
  • Milwaukee Metropolitan Community Concert Band at the War Memorial Center Third Floor. Music starts at 4 p.m.

Directions to the War Memorial Center, 750 N. Lincoln Memorial Drive, Milwaukee, WI 53202:

Follow I-94 or I-43 downtown to the I-794 east. Take exit 1F, the Lakefront exit.

Take Lincoln Memorial Drive north through the stoplights at East Michigan Street, and pass under the Mason Street Bridge.

The turn for the parking lot will come up quickly on your right. Parking at this lot is free on Memorial Day.
